Hermit’s Cove is located at Kantabogon Road, Aloguinsan, Cebu. If you want to have this place on your travel bucket list, below are the details so you can have an idea for you next itinerary.
Entrance 7:00 A.M-5:00 P.M - ₱100 w/ free cottage & FREE grilling station
OVERNIGHT AVAILABLE
5:00 P.M Onwards/Overnight - ₱200
Tent Rental Pax for 3pax - ₱200
Or bring your own tent - ₱50
Kayaking for 300 per hour
HOW TO GET THERE:
If via private car, use waze app to help you navigate.
If via commute, ride a bus at the Cebu South Bus Terminal going to Aloguinsan. Stop at the town’s market and ride a tricycle/motor to get to Hermit’s

Hermit’s Cove also has a "kantil" or a sudden drop/slope of the ocean floor where the water changes its color. For thrill-seekers or extreme divers, it may be a good spot to swim. It was actually a blessing to have this kind of beach that is affordable yet majestic place. I was even amazed knowing that their cottages are free of charge unlike other beaches and resorts. And the local people are also the one who takes good care of the beach. They are the one who cleans everyday and manages the place. Basically, the entrance fee will be their salary and maintenance of the place. So it is all in one go because while maintaining the place, they could also provide work to the local people.
Just remember to manage you expectations because this place lacks amenities but surely it has a comfort room and shower area but as for the shower area you need to pay 10 pesos for an unlimited fresh water in a bucket. If you wanted to try some activities, they also offer kayaking for only 300 pesos. And if you wanted to visit nearby beaches you can also rent a boat that will take you to there like the Bojo River.
